> Its not hidden data, its the limitations of floating point arithmetic. VMD
> reads in the decimal number, and stores it internally as the nearest double
> precision floating point number. Since floating point uses base 2, not base
> 10, many decimal numbers cannot be cleanly expressed, and are rounded
> internally to their closest floating point representation. Tcl returns this
> floating point representation converted back to decimal, which usually
> means a number with 15-16 digits after the decimal place.

> I would disagree with that.
>
> here is why:
>
> This is in the pdb:
> 71.696 112.940 -84.327
>
> after using the code the output is:
>
> {71.69599914550781 112.94000244140625 -84.3270034790039}
>
> If you observe the x-coordinates -- 71.696 is in the PDB which is being
> read into TCL by the script i sent earlier and it shows 71.695999 .,.. that
> means that PDB TEXT file was displaying a rounded off number. Where as --
> somehow when the TCL script read the PDB TEXT file ... it produced --
> 71.69599.. which is the un-rounded off number.
